    our house located in 10mins-walking from JR line. called sodegaura station.
    it's 1hr 20 mins to tokyo stn.¥1170/ one way. not too bad for tourists.I guess?
    neighbors is quiet, not like fancy High-Tec city but If you like the rural area, or natures too.
    we ride a bike a lot too. we have a lot of parks around and check "Chibafornia" not California. ^o^
